Renowned Indian artist, Atul Dodiya recently opened his first solo exhibition at 10 Chancery Lane in Hong Kong. The exhibition, which is entitled Duplicator's Dilemma, takes places contemporaneously with the opening of an extensive survey of Dodiya’s work at the National Gallery of Modern Art in New Delhi. Throughout his career, Dodiya has bought together and juxtaposed references from politics, art history and folklore for his work, as well as Indian and North American popular culture. He is probably best known for creating this amalgamation of visual imagery upon the metallic surface of shutter doors taken from Delhi shop fronts. The earliest shutter works were commissioned by the TATE Modern for its Century City exhibition, and now the latest iteration of this series appears in Hong Kong in the form of three large shutter works, which are contrasted beautifully with several delicate and poetic watercolours that also appear in the exhibition. Anna Dickie spoke to Atul Dodiya about his career, including what inspired him to become an artist, his passion for art history, and how his work reflects on India.

TEA TIME TALK & TOUR WITH KATIE DE TILLY - PARALLEL LIVES (CHAI WAN)
26 Jun 2013
Katie de Tilly will give a private talk and tour of Parallel Lives by Yang Zhichao and Douglas Young on Saturday 29th June at 3pm.
The exhibition Parallel Lives pairs two artists Douglas Young born in Hong kong and Yang Zhichao born in China in an amazing documentary exhibition at our brand new indoor / outdoor space.
More information:
Yang Zhichao was born in China in the year of the dragon 1964/1965 as was Hong Kong artist and designer Douglas Young who coincidentally shares the same name in Chinese: Yang Zhichao (楊志超). Parallel Lives explores a slice of history between two overlapping lives separated by a boarder of Hong Kong and China. Yang Zhichao spent four years collecting the personal notebooks of 3,000 individuals dating from 1949-1999. His series entitled, Chinese Bible covers 50 years of history within the writings of personal notebooks. Douglas Young is obsessed with Hong Kong’s recent past and collects objects from his lifetime that are now disappearing in the fast changing modernization of the city. The objects themselves are not antiques nor are valuable but they speak volumes about Hong Kong’s daily life in the past 50 years. Parallel Lives is an exhibition of collective memory by two very different artists who share a commonality of age and name as well as search yet have never met.

HUNG LIU: OFFERINGS, OPENING 23RD JANUARY AT MILLS COLLEGE, OAKLAND, CALIFORNIA, USA
22 Jan 2013
The Mills College Art Museum, Oakland, California is pleased to present Hung Liu: Offerings, a rare opportunity to experience two of the Oakland-based artist’s most significant large-scale installations: Jui Jin Shan (Old Gold Mountain) (1994) and Tai Cang—Great Granary (2008). The exhibition examines the themes of memory, history, and cultural identity through works that navigate the life-long liminal experiences of immigration and homecoming.
